Microsoft has issued an urgent security advisory for CVE-2025-58714, a critical elevation-of-privilege vulnerability in the Windows Ancillary Function Driver for WinSock that enables attackers to gain SYSTEM-level privileges on affected systems. This high-severity flaw, rated 7.8 on the CVSS scale, affects multiple Windows versions and requires immediate patching to prevent exploitation by malicious actors.
Understanding the Technical Details
The vulnerability resides within the Ancillary Function Driver (AFD), a critical Windows kernel component that manages Winsock operations. AFD.sys serves as the interface between user-mode applications and the Windows networking stack, handling socket operations, I/O completion, and network protocol management. The specific flaw involves improper handling of objects in memory, creating a use-after-free condition that attackers can exploit to execute arbitrary code with elevated privileges.
According to Microsoft's security advisory, an attacker must first gain access to the target system through valid login credentials or by exploiting another vulnerability. Once authenticated, they can run a specially crafted application that triggers the vulnerability, allowing them to escalate from standard user privileges to SYSTEM-level access. This makes the vulnerability particularly dangerous in multi-user environments or scenarios where attackers have already compromised user accounts.
Affected Windows Versions
Search results confirm that CVE-2025-58714 impacts a broad range of Windows operating systems:
- Windows 11 versions 23H2 and 22H2
- Windows 10 versions 21H2, 22H2, and earlier supported releases
- Windows Server 2022 and Windows Server 2019
- Windows Server 2016 and earlier server editions still in support
The vulnerability affects both client and server editions, making comprehensive patch deployment essential across enterprise environments. Microsoft has confirmed that Windows 7, Windows 8.1, and Windows Server 2012 R2 are not affected, as they're no longer receiving security updates.
Exploitation Methodology and Attack Vectors
Security researchers have identified several potential attack vectors for CVE-2025-58714. The primary exploitation method involves:
- Local Execution: Attackers with standard user privileges can execute malicious code that triggers the vulnerability
- Malware Integration: Existing malware can incorporate exploit code to elevate privileges and bypass security controls
- Lateral Movement: In enterprise environments, attackers can use compromised user accounts to exploit the vulnerability across multiple systems
The exploitation process typically involves:
- Gaining initial access through phishing, credential theft, or other means
- Executing a specially crafted application that targets the AFD driver
- Triggering the use-after-free condition to corrupt kernel memory
- Gaining SYSTEM privileges and establishing persistence
Patch Deployment and Mitigation Strategies
Microsoft has released security updates through Windows Update, Windows Server Update Services (WSUS), and the Microsoft Update Catalog. Organizations should prioritize deployment using the following methods:
Immediate Actions Required
- Deploy Security Updates: Install the latest cumulative updates for affected Windows versions immediately
- Enable Automatic Updates: Ensure Windows Update is configured to automatically install security patches
- Verify Patch Installation: Use tools like Windows Update History or PowerShell commands to confirm successful deployment
Alternative Mitigations
While patching remains the primary solution, organizations facing deployment challenges can implement temporary mitigations:
- Application Control: Deploy application whitelisting solutions like Windows Defender Application Control
- Privilege Management: Implement least-privilege principles to limit user account capabilities
- Network Segmentation: Isolate critical systems to contain potential breaches
- Monitoring and Detection: Enhance security monitoring for privilege escalation attempts
Enterprise Impact and Risk Assessment
The CVE-2025-58714 vulnerability presents significant risks to enterprise environments:
Critical Infrastructure Concerns
Organizations running Windows Server in critical infrastructure roles face particular risks. The ability to gain SYSTEM privileges could enable attackers to:
- Compromise domain controllers and Active Directory services
- Access sensitive data and intellectual property
- Disrupt business operations and service availability
- Establish persistent backdoors for future attacks
Compliance and Regulatory Implications
Failure to patch this vulnerability could violate multiple compliance frameworks:
- NIST Cybersecurity Framework requirements for vulnerability management
- HIPAA security rules for healthcare organizations
- PCI DSS requirements for payment card processing environments
- GDPR data protection obligations for European data
Historical Context and Similar Vulnerabilities
CVE-2025-58714 follows a pattern of similar AFD driver vulnerabilities that have emerged in recent years. Notable precedents include:
- CVE-2023-21768: A Windows AFD driver elevation of privilege vulnerability patched in January 2023
- CVE-2021-24092: Another AFD driver flaw that allowed local privilege escalation
- CVE-2020-0796: The "SMBGhost" vulnerability that also involved kernel-level exploitation
These recurring issues highlight the ongoing challenges in securing Windows kernel components and the importance of robust patch management programs.
Detection and Monitoring Recommendations
Security teams should implement comprehensive monitoring to detect potential exploitation attempts:
SIEM and EDR Configuration
- Monitor for unusual process creation with SYSTEM privileges
- Track AFD.sys driver access and modification attempts
- Alert on privilege escalation patterns and suspicious kernel activity
- Implement behavioral analytics to detect anomalous system calls
Windows Security Log Monitoring
Configure audit policies to capture relevant security events:
Audit Policy: Audit privilege use (Success, Failure)
Audit Policy: Audit process creation (Success)
Audit Policy: Audit kernel object (Success)
Patch Management Best Practices
Organizations should follow established patch management frameworks to ensure comprehensive protection:
Testing and Validation
- Test patches in isolated environments before production deployment
- Validate critical application compatibility
- Monitor for performance impacts or system instability
- Maintain rollback plans for emergency scenarios
Deployment Strategies
- Prioritize deployment based on system criticality and exposure
- Use phased rollout approaches to minimize business disruption
- Leverage automation tools for consistent patch application
- Document deployment processes and maintain audit trails
Long-term Security Implications
The discovery of CVE-2025-58714 underscores several ongoing security challenges:
Driver Security Concerns
The repeated discovery of vulnerabilities in Windows kernel drivers raises questions about:
- Driver development and testing practices
- Third-party driver certification processes
- Kernel memory protection mechanisms
- Driver isolation and sandboxing capabilities
Enterprise Security Posture
Organizations must reassess their security strategies in light of such vulnerabilities:
- Defense in Depth: Implement multiple security layers to contain breaches
- Zero Trust Architecture: Assume compromise and verify all access requests
- Continuous Monitoring: Maintain real-time visibility into system activities
- Incident Response: Develop comprehensive plans for security incidents
Conclusion and Future Outlook
CVE-2025-58714 represents a significant security threat that demands immediate attention from Windows administrators and security professionals. The vulnerability's ability to enable local privilege escalation makes it a valuable tool for attackers seeking to compromise enterprise environments.
While Microsoft has provided patches, the broader security community must remain vigilant for:
- Potential exploit code development and distribution
- Integration of the vulnerability into malware frameworks
- Emergence of similar vulnerabilities in related components
- Evolution of attack techniques targeting kernel-level flaws
Organizations that prioritize patch deployment, implement robust security controls, and maintain comprehensive monitoring will be best positioned to defend against this and future vulnerabilities. The ongoing discovery of such flaws reinforces the need for continuous security improvement and proactive risk management in today's threat landscape.